新浪微博图床API在网上已经很多且大都封装成了API供别人调用,这里分享其核心代码。支持前台跨域请求,以POST方式提交图片即可。新浪图床可以将你的图片远程上传到新浪服务器,你可以选择调用本站的接口,也可以利用本站的 API 接口封装成自己的接口。
![14350bd58e93fd2ae5bf328075d57366.png](https://img-blog.csdnimg.cn/img_convert/14350bd58e93fd2ae5bf328075d57366.png)
#新浪图床API请求方式 #
Method: GET/POST
# 请求地址 #
https://api.ooopn.com/tu/sina/api.php
# 请求参数 #
url //上传图片的地址(必填)
v //三种图片输出尺寸,small,middle,large(选填)
# 返回参数 #
code //状态码,200-上传成功;201-上传失败;203-cookie获取失败;404-请勿直接访问
width //图床图片宽度
height //图床图片高度
size //图床图片大小
pid //图床图片id
imgurl //图床图片地址
msg //错误状态
# 调用示例 #
https://api.ooopn.com/tu/sina/api.php?url=图片地址
https://api.ooopn.com/tu/sina/api.php?v=small&url=图片地址
# 返回数据 #
{"code":"200